The Cost Of Short Term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ation in Ashley, Ohio

Most individuals suffering from drug addiction typically discover the cost of a rehab program is too high. Therefore, they may decide to forgo treatment - forgetting that addiction is typically more expensive in the long run.

Depending on the form of treatment you decide on, you can be sure that the facility will require you to handle the rather expensive costs. Yet, there are reasonably affordable treatment programs in Ashley that you can use to reduce these costs - including short term drug treatment.

Short term treatment is more affordable than long-term therapy because you will only be in treatment for a limited period. Therefore, here you have a lower priced option that you can count on to handle your substance abuse and addiction.

In some cases, you may even discover that your insurance company will cover the cost of rehabilitation if you choose short term rehab. Although, many insurances have limits on the total amount they may cover - or the entire duration of treatment that they will pay for. Still, many short term programs are sufficiently covered by insurance.

Thus, if the cost of treatment is a significant deciding factor for you, short term rehabilitation might be the ideal solution. As much as you may want to receive the best, most comprehensive form of rehabilitation, your finances might prevent you from being able to choose other options like long term substance abuse rehabilitation.

Even with this fairly low cost, short term drug and alcohol treatment could possibly work for you. Yet, the success of the program will greatly depend on you as an individual. If your substance abuse has been ongoing for a long time, it is unlikely that this duration of rehabilitation will work for you. Due to the fact that it is more appropriate for people who have only just started showing signs of substance abuse and addiction.

Ultimately, short term drug rehab is ideal for addicts who have not been using drugs or alcohol for a long time and for those who are unable to afford a longer rehab program.
